We present a measurement of the branching fraction and fraction of longitudinal polarization of B0→ρ+ρ- decays, which have two π0's in the final state. We also measure time-dependent CP violation parameters for decays into longitudinally polarized ρ+ρ- pairs. This analysis is based on a data sample containing (387±6)×106 ϒ(4S) mesons collected with the Belle II detector at the SuperKEKB asymmetric-energy e+e- collider in 2019-2022. We obtain B(B0→ρ+ρ-)=(2.89-0.22+0.23 -0.27+0.29)×10-5, fL=0.921-0.025+0.024 -0.015+0.017, S=-0.26±0.19±0.08, and C=-0.02±0.12-0.05+0.06, where the first uncertainties are statistical and the second are systematic. We use these results to perform an isospin analysis to constrain the Cabibbo-Kobayashi-Maskawa angle φ2 and obtain two solutions; the result consistent with other Standard Model constraints is φ2=(92.6-4.7+4.5)°.
